Mahamadou Diarra's first-half header was enough for Real Madrid to beat Real Betis in Seville last night.
The win lifts Madrid to the top of the standings ahead of Sunday's clashes, while defeat ends a miserable week for Betis which began with a derby loss to Sevilla.
Real coach Fabio Capello said afterwards: "You can see that the team is improving and is playing with more rhythm. We played a good game, though they came back at us hard with the introduction of the German (David Odonkor).
"Betis had only one chance throughout the game, the header for Juanito. We had several more chances and controlled the game well."
Fullback Cicinho limped off with suspected knee ligament damage, though Capello said: "We'll wait to see what the doctors say."
